I’ve heard you can go blind from this
but I decided to stare at the sun,
after…
behind my eyelids,
darkness broke
into overlays and auras ultraviolet
quivering
around a green corn moon,
bristles of dog hair fear rising, chasing solar filaments until the orb acquiesced
and drifted back into darkness,
behind my eyelids,
and after all that
I didn’t even bother to go
blind
